How they compare
Zimbabwe currently reports 322 against 227 in Philippines, a difference of 95.
That makes Zimbabwe's figure about 1.4 times Philippines's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 5 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Philippines ahead.
Philippines ranks 58th and Zimbabwe ranks 55th of 79 countries.
Philippines has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
